Application: krunner (0.1) KDE Platform Version: 4.4.1 (KDE 4.4.1) Qt Version: 4.6.2 Operating System: Linux 2.6.31-20-generic x86_64 Distribution: Ubuntu 9.10 -- Information about the crash: KRunner crashed while I was typing part of the name of what I was looking for. It only happened once, I've been unable to trigger the crash again. -- Backtrace: Application: Interfaz de ejecución de órdenes (kdeinit4), signal: Segmentation fault __lll_lock_wait_private () at ../nptl/sysdeps/unix/sysv/linux/x86_64/lowlevellock.S:97 in ../nptl/sysdeps/unix/sysv/linux/x86_64/lowlevellock.S The current source language is "auto; currently asm". [Current thread is 1 (Thread 0x7fe4f155c7f0 (LWP 2482))] Thread 5 (Thread 0x7fe4cdf0d910 (LWP 3243)): #0 __lll_lock_wait_private () at ../nptl/sysdeps/unix/sysv/linux/x86_64/lowlevellock.S:97 #1 0x00007fe4ee503b11 in _L_lock_9274 () from /lib/libc.so.6 #2 0x00007fe4ee501741 in *__GI___libc_free (mem=0x7fe4c0000020) at malloc.c:3714 #3 0x00007fe4f05a52a4 in KDirListerCache::forgetDirs (this=0x2217d50, lister=0x7fe4c0001300, _url=<value optimized out>, notify=<value optimized out>) at ../../kio/kio/kdirlister.cpp:564 #4 0x00007fe4f05a5c84 in KDirListerCache::forgetDirs (this=0x2217d50, lister=0x7fe4c0001300) at ../../kio/kio/kdirlister.cpp:462 #5 0x00007fe4f05a5f1c in ~KDirLister (this=0x7fe4c0001300, __in_chrg=<value optimized out>) at ../../kio/kio/kdirlister.cpp:1939 #6 0x00007fe4efb347fc in QObjectPrivate::deleteChildren (this=0x23feb10) at kernel/qobject.cpp:1986 #7 0x00007fe4efb3b8c4 in ~QObject (this=<value optimized out>, __in_chrg=<value optimized out>) at kernel/qobject.cpp:975 #8 0x00007fe4d0afb1aa in ~KFilePlacesItem (this=0x24e81f0, __in_chrg=<value optimized out>) at ../../kfile/kfileplacesitem.cpp:66 #9 0x00007fe4d0b00bd7 in qDeleteAll<QList<KFilePlacesItem*>::const_iterator> (this=0x7fe4cdf0cd20, __in_chrg=<value optimized out>) at /usr/include/qt4/QtCore/qalgorithms.h:322 #10 qDeleteAll<QList<KFilePlacesItem*> > (this=0x7fe4cdf0cd20, __in_chrg=<value optimized out>) at /usr/include/qt4/QtCore/qalgorithms.h:330 #11 ~Private (this=0x7fe4cdf0cd20, __in_chrg=<value optimized out>) at ../../kfile/kfileplacesmodel.cpp:60 #12 ~KFilePlacesModel (this=0x7fe4cdf0cd20, __in_chrg=<value optimized out>) at ../../kfile/kfileplacesmodel.cpp:160 #13 0x00007fe4d0d5efea in PlacesRunner::match (this=<value optimized out>, context=<value optimized out>) at ../../../../../plasma/generic/runners/places/placesrunner.cpp:90 #14 0x00007fe4e7a9b32a in Plasma::AbstractRunner::performMatch (this=0x2162f10, localContext=...) at ../../plasma/abstractrunner.cpp:117 #15 0x00007fe4e5f8297d in ThreadWeaver::JobRunHelper::runTheJob (this=0x7fe4cdf0cf20, th=0x225a180, job=0x20ba520) at ../../../threadweaver/Weaver/Job.cpp:106 #16 0x00007fe4e5f82c7e in ThreadWeaver::Job::execute (this=0x20ba520, th=0x225a180) at ../../../threadweaver/Weaver/Job.cpp:135 #17 0x00007fe4e5f81bcf in ThreadWeaver::ThreadRunHelper::run (this=0x7fe4cdf0cfb0, parent=0x1d40d70, th=0x225a180) at ../../../threadweaver/Weaver/Thread.cpp:95 #18 0x00007fe4e5f82058 in ThreadWeaver::Thread::run (this=0x225a180) at ../../../threadweaver/Weaver/Thread.cpp:142 #19 0x00007fe4efa31775 in QThreadPrivate::start (arg=0x225a180) at thread/qthread_unix.cpp:248 #20 0x00007fe4ef7a2a04 in start_thread (arg=<value optimized out>) at pthread_create.c:300 #21 0x00007fe4ee56680d in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:112 #22 0x0000000000000000 in ?? () Thread 4 (Thread 0x7fe4c7044910 (LWP 3244)): #0 pthread_cond_wait@@GLIBC_2.3.2 () at ../nptl/sysdeps/unix/sysv/linux/x86_64/pthread_cond_wait.S:261 #1 0x00007fe4efa3272b in QWaitConditionPrivate::wait (this=<value optimized out>, mutex=0x1ce2650, time=18446744073709551615) at thread/qwaitcondition_unix.cpp:87 #2 QWaitCondition::wait (this=<value optimized out>, mutex=0x1ce2650, time=18446744073709551615) at thread/qwaitcondition_unix.cpp:159 #3 0x00007fe4e5f81096 in ThreadWeaver::WeaverImpl::blockThreadUntilJobsAreBeingAssigned (this=0x1d40d70, th=0x22db810) at ../../../threadweaver/Weaver/WeaverImpl.cpp:365 #4 0x00007fe4e5f8374b in ThreadWeaver::WorkingHardState::applyForWork (this=0x1c9bce0, th=0x22db810) at ../../../threadweaver/Weaver/WorkingHardState.cpp:71 #5 0x00007fe4e5f81bff in ThreadWeaver::ThreadRunHelper::run (this=0x7fe4c7043fb0, parent=0x1d40d70, th=0x22db810) at ../../../threadweaver/Weaver/Thread.cpp:87 #6 0x00007fe4e5f82058 in ThreadWeaver::Thread::run (this=0x22db810) at ../../../threadweaver/Weaver/Thread.cpp:142 #7 0x00007fe4efa31775 in QThreadPrivate::start (arg=0x22db810) at thread/qthread_unix.cpp:248 #8 0x00007fe4ef7a2a04 in start_thread (arg=<value optimized out>) at pthread_create.c:300 #9 0x00007fe4ee56680d in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:112 #10 0x0000000000000000 in ?? () Thread 3 (Thread 0x7fe4c6843910 (LWP 3245)): [KCrash Handler] #5 malloc_consolidate (av=0x7fe4c0000020) at malloc.c:5095 #6 0x00007fe4ee4fe518 in _int_free (av=0x7fe4c0000020, p=0x7fe4c0003430) at malloc.c:4968 #7 0x00007fe4ee50174c in *__GI___libc_free (mem=<value optimized out>) at malloc.c:3716 #8 0x00007fe4efa7630c in QString::free (d=0x7fe4c0003440) at tools/qstring.cpp:1108 #9 0x00007fe4d0afebe0 in ~QString (this=0x211e510) at /usr/include/qt4/QtCore/qstring.h:869 #10 KFilePlacesModel::Private::loadBookmarkList (this=0x211e510) at ../../kfile/kfileplacesmodel.cpp:420 #11 0x00007fe4d0afef30 in KFilePlacesModel::Private::_k_reloadBookmarks (this=0x211e510) at ../../kfile/kfileplacesmodel.cpp:342 #12 0x00007fe4d0b002d3 in KFilePlacesModel (this=0x7fe4c6842d20, parent=<value optimized out>) at ../../kfile/kfileplacesmodel.cpp:154 #13 0x00007fe4d0d5f0c8 in PlacesRunner::match (this=<value optimized out>, context=<value optimized out>) at ../../../../../plasma/generic/runners/places/placesrunner.cpp:54 #14 0x00007fe4e7a9b32a in Plasma::AbstractRunner::performMatch (this=0x2162f10, localContext=...) at ../../plasma/abstractrunner.cpp:117 #15 0x00007fe4e5f8297d in ThreadWeaver::JobRunHelper::runTheJob (this=0x7fe4c6842f20, th=0x22beee0, job=0x22ddcd0) at ../../../threadweaver/Weaver/Job.cpp:106 #16 0x00007fe4e5f82c7e in ThreadWeaver::Job::execute (this=0x22ddcd0, th=0x22beee0) at ../../../threadweaver/Weaver/Job.cpp:135 #17 0x00007fe4e5f81bcf in ThreadWeaver::ThreadRunHelper::run (this=0x7fe4c6842fb0, parent=0x1d40d70, th=0x22beee0) at ../../../threadweaver/Weaver/Thread.cpp:95 #18 0x00007fe4e5f82058 in ThreadWeaver::Thread::run (this=0x22beee0) at ../../../threadweaver/Weaver/Thread.cpp:142 #19 0x00007fe4efa31775 in QThreadPrivate::start (arg=0x22beee0) at thread/qthread_unix.cpp:248 #20 0x00007fe4ef7a2a04 in start_thread (arg=<value optimized out>) at pthread_create.c:300 #21 0x00007fe4ee56680d in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:112 #22 0x0000000000000000 in ?? () Thread 2 (Thread 0x7fe4c6042910 (LWP 3246)): #0 pthread_cond_wait@@GLIBC_2.3.2 () at ../nptl/sysdeps/unix/sysv/linux/x86_64/pthread_cond_wait.S:261 #1 0x00007fe4efa3272b in QWaitConditionPrivate::wait (this=<value optimized out>, mutex=0x1ce2650, time=18446744073709551615) at thread/qwaitcondition_unix.cpp:87 #2 QWaitCondition::wait (this=<value optimized out>, mutex=0x1ce2650, time=18446744073709551615) at thread/qwaitcondition_unix.cpp:159 #3 0x00007fe4e5f81096 in ThreadWeaver::WeaverImpl::blockThreadUntilJobsAreBeingAssigned (this=0x1d40d70, th=0x22ce1a0) at ../../../threadweaver/Weaver/WeaverImpl.cpp:365 #4 0x00007fe4e5f8374b in ThreadWeaver::WorkingHardState::applyForWork (this=0x1c9bce0, th=0x22ce1a0) at ../../../threadweaver/Weaver/WorkingHardState.cpp:71 #5 0x00007fe4e5f81bff in ThreadWeaver::ThreadRunHelper::run (this=0x7fe4c6041fb0, parent=0x1d40d70, th=0x22ce1a0) at ../../../threadweaver/Weaver/Thread.cpp:87 #6 0x00007fe4e5f82058 in ThreadWeaver::Thread::run (this=0x22ce1a0) at ../../../threadweaver/Weaver/Thread.cpp:142 #7 0x00007fe4efa31775 in QThreadPrivate::start (arg=0x22ce1a0) at thread/qthread_unix.cpp:248 #8 0x00007fe4ef7a2a04 in start_thread (arg=<value optimized out>) at pthread_create.c:300 #9 0x00007fe4ee56680d in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:112 #10 0x0000000000000000 in ?? () The current source language is "auto; currently c". Thread 1 (Thread 0x7fe4f155c7f0 (LWP 2482)): #0 __lll_lock_wait_private () at ../nptl/sysdeps/unix/sysv/linux/x86_64/lowlevellock.S:97 #1 0x00007fe4ee503b11 in _L_lock_9274 () from /lib/libc.so.6 #2 0x00007fe4ee501741 in *__GI___libc_free (mem=0x7fe4c0000020) at malloc.c:3714 #3 0x00007fe4efb53644 in QTimerInfoList::unregisterTimer (this=0x1b89fa0, timerId=33554443) at kernel/qeventdispatcher_unix.cpp:500 #4 0x00007fe4efb40201 in QTimer::stop (this=0x2219488) at kernel/qtimer.cpp:257 #5 0x00007fe4efb4085d in QTimer::timerEvent (this=0x7fe4c0000020, e=0x80) at kernel/qtimer.cpp:270 #6 0x00007fe4efb35863 in QObject::event (this=0x2219488, e=0x7ffff048f800) at kernel/qobject.cpp:1212 #7 0x00007fe4eecc412c in QApplicationPrivate::notify_helper (this=0x1b867a0, receiver=0x2219488, e=0x7ffff048f800) at kernel/qapplication.cpp:4300 #8 0x00007fe4eecca71b in QApplication::notify (this=0x1b86460, receiver=0x2219488, e=0x7ffff048f800) at kernel/qapplication.cpp:4183 #9 0x00007fe4f006dd76 in KApplication::notify (this=0x1b86460, receiver=0x2219488, event=0x7ffff048f800) at ../../kdeui/kernel/kapplication.cpp:302 #10 0x00007fe4efb25e0c in QCoreApplication::notifyInternal (this=0x1b86460, receiver=0x2219488, event=0x7ffff048f800) at kernel/qcoreapplication.cpp:704 #11 0x00007fe4efb52a62 in QCoreApplication::sendEvent (this=0x1b89fa0) at ../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:215 #12 QTimerInfoList::activateTimers (this=0x1b89fa0) at kernel/qeventdispatcher_unix.cpp:603 #13 0x00007fe4efb4f668 in timerSourceDispatch (source=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:184 #14 idleTimerSourceDispatch (source=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:231 #15 0x00007fe4ead28bce in g_main_context_dispatch () from /lib/libglib-2.0.so.0 #16 0x00007fe4ead2c598 in ?? () from /lib/libglib-2.0.so.0 #17 0x00007fe4ead2c6c0 in g_main_context_iteration () from /lib/libglib-2.0.so.0 #18 0x00007fe4efb4f333 in QEventDispatcherGlib::processEvents (this=0x1af81c0, flags=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:412 #19 0x00007fe4eed73f0e in QGuiEventDispatcherGlib::processEvents (this=0x7fe4c0000020, flags=<value optimized out>) at kernel/qguieventdispatcher_glib.cpp:204 #20 0x00007fe4efb24732 in QEventLoop::processEvents (this=<value optimized out>, flags=) at kernel/qeventloop.cpp:149 #21 0x00007fe4efb24b0c in QEventLoop::exec (this=0x7ffff048faa0, flags=) at kernel/qeventloop.cpp:201 #22 0x00007fe4efb2884b in QCoreApplication::exec () at kernel/qcoreapplication.cpp:981 #23 0x00007fe4e33bd7d4 in kdemain (argc=<value optimized out>, argv=<value optimized out>) at ../../krunner/main.cpp:65 #24 0x0000000000406fb8 in launch (argc=1, _name=<value optimized out>, args=<value optimized out>, cwd=<value optimized out>, envc=0, envs=<value optimized out>, reset_env=false, tty=0x0, avoid_loops=false, startup_id_str=0x40a499 "0") at ../../kinit/kinit.cpp:717 #25 0x0000000000407c70 in handle_launcher_request (sock=9, who=<value optimized out>) at ../../kinit/kinit.cpp:1209 #26 0x0000000000408121 in handle_requests (waitForPid=0) at ../../kinit/kinit.cpp:1402 #27 0x0000000000408df2 in main (argc=4, argv=<value optimized out>, envp=<value optimized out>) at ../../kinit/kinit.cpp:1841 The current source language is "auto; currently asm". Reported using DrKonqi
Similar bug reports are being tracked at bug 224212. Regards *** This bug has been marked as a duplicate of bug 224212 ***